TO THE HONORABLE COURT, AND TO ALL PARTIES AND THEIR

2 COUNSEL OF RECORD: 3
For the purpose of clarifying the docket and record in this action,

4 Defendant/Counterclaimant Danrick Commerce Group, LLC ("Danrick") and Defendant Danny 5 Louie ("Louie") hereby file this statement in response to the purported "Joint Case Management 6 Statement" ("Knoll's CMC Statement") filed in this action as Docket No. 19 by 7 Plaintiff/Counterdefendant Knoll, Inc. ("Knoll"). Knoll's CMC Statement was initially filed as 8 Docket No. 36 in the related case of Alphaville Design, Inc. v. Knoll, Inc., Case No. 07-CV-55699 MHP. Danrick and Louie are not parties to that action, were erroneously sued pursuant to 10 purported "counterclaims" by Knoll in that action, have never been served with a summons in that 11 action, and did not participate in the Fed. R. Civ. P. 26 conference or communicate with Knoll 12 regarding the preparation of a case management statement in that action. In fact, Danrick and 13 Louie have requested that Knoll officially dismiss them from Knoll's erroneously-filed 14 "counterclaims" in that action. But for some unexplained reason, Knoll filed its Case Management 15 Statement from that action (i.e., Docket No. 36 in Case No. 07-CV-5569-MHP) as Docket No. 19 16 in this action as well, creating potential confusion as to whether Danrick and Louie participated or 17 are somehow parties to that action and case management process, which they are not. 18
Danrick and Louie did not participate with Knoll in the preparation of Knoll's Case

19 Management Statement or in the meet and confer process leading thereto in the separate but 20 related Alphaville Action (Case No. 07-CV-5569-MHP) because, as explained above, Danrick and 21 Louie are not parties to that action. Knoll has now filed three separate actions against Danrick and 22 Louie for the same purported claims (one in the Southern District of New York which was 23 dismissed, and now two more here in the Northern District of California), thereby increasing the 24 unfair expense and burden to Danrick and Louie, which are a small company that is a customer of 25 Alphaville Design, Inc. (Danrick) and one of Danrick's owners (Louie). 26
